Visa sponsorship changes for the fast food industry

04 March 2017

The federal government has barred fast food chains from sponsoring foreign workers to work in Australia.

JUMP TO:
JUMP TO:

The Minister said Australian workers, particularly young Australians, must be given priority.

This decision will not impact current labour agreements however, these companies will not be able to seek a renewal of their labour agreement on expiry or termination. Businesses who believe that a labour agreement is still warranted on the grounds that exceptional circumstances exist can still request a labour agreement.

Companies should be aware that they will need to put forward a very strong case with supporting evidence to demonstrate that:

  • there is in fact a skills shortage in the context of a particular store/position
  • they have reduced their reliance on overseas workers.
